The Company

Since the 1970s, the Briggs Group has grown to become one of the world leaders in the marine and environmental services industry, currently employing over 800 dedicated members of staff.

Providing clients with services ranging from terminal operations to subsea cable repair, we are committed to employing dedicated and skilled staff who are looking for a career that offers stability, genuine career progression, and recognition.

Our core values support the Company’s mission and decision-making and provide a benchmark for everything that we believe in. They are the Company’s fundamental beliefs and are integrated into every employee process, shaping the Company’s culture for future success.

The Role

We’re looking for a proactive Buyer/Procurement Specialist to source goods, materials, and services that support our operational requirements. You’ll manage suppliers, negotiate pricing, and ensure stock availability to keep our business running smoothly.

Key Responsibilities

Raise purchase orders and manage end-to-end procurement activity.

Source and evaluate suppliers; negotiate competitive terms.

Monitor supplier performance and resolve supply issues.

Maintain accurate pricing, lead times, and procurement data.

Work with operations and warehouse teams to ensure optimal stock levels.

Support cost-saving initiatives and continuous improvement.

The Candidate

Experienced Buyer/Procurement Specialist.

Strong negotiation and supplier management skills.

Confident using ERP/procurement systems such as Sage 500, Sage Intacct, SAP, Oracle, etc.

Excellent communication, organisation, and attention to detail.

CIPS qualification or working towards it.
